Answer: By introducing pollutant-consuming microorganisms.

Bioremediation is a process which belongs to the branch of biotechnology. It deals with the application of living organisms like microbes, plants, plant enzymes to degrade or utilize the organic waste from  contaminated ground water, sewage sources, soil and other polluted sites.

The introduction of microorganisms will lead to the consumption of the organic waste present in water of lake or other source and sewage waste management. Hence, it will improve the quality of water and will help in getting rid off the sewage waste.

What happens to a virus involved in the lysogenic cycle?
-Dominant- [34]

Answer:

The lytic cycle involves the reproduction of viruses using a host cell to manufacture more viruses; the viruses then burst out of the cell. The lysogenic cycle involves the incorporation of the viral genome into the host cell genome, infecting it from within.
